Formulation and Penetration Study of Liposome Xanthone of Mangosteen Pericarp Methanol Extract (Garcinia mangostana L.)
      Desy Muliana Wenas, Mahdi Jufri, Berna Elya
Abstract: Liposome is a drug carrier system that can enhance the effectiveness of drug delivery which is made from the lipid that easily penetrated into the skin. The methanol extract of mangosteen pericarp (Garcinia mangostana L.) has been proved rich in xanthone compounds that have very high potential of antioxidant activity, especially the fractionation of dichloromethane (FD). The aim of this study to test the penetration ability of liposome cream throughout mouse’s skin. The FD has been used in making liposome as triploid. The precipitate of liposome with the best entrapment efficiency of liposome (77,09%) is used in making liposome cream (LC) with 5%, 10% and 15% concentration. The liposome had been made as triploid and the precipitate of the liposome with the best entrapment efficiency will be used in LC.
